{"passport":{"unfragile":{"@version":"1.0","version":"2026-05","artifact":{"id":"smithery_nova-3951-agents-md","slug":"nova-3951-agents-md","name":"agents-md","type":"mcp","url":"https://github.com/NOVA-3951/AGENTS.MD","page_url":"https://unfragile.ai/nova-3951-agents-md","categories":["mcp-servers"],"tags":["mcp","model-context-protocol","smithery:NOVA-3951/agents-md"],"pricing":{"model":"open_source","free":true,"starting_price":null},"status":"active","verified":false},"capabilities":[{"id":"smithery_nova-3951-agents-md__cap_0","uri":"capability://tool.use.integration.schema.based.function.calling.with.multi.provider.support","name":"schema-based function calling with multi-provider support","description":"This capability allows agents to call functions defined in a schema that supports multiple providers, enabling seamless integration with various APIs. It uses a structured approach to define function signatures and types, ensuring that calls are validated against the schema before execution. This design choice enhances interoperability and reduces runtime errors, making it distinct from simpler function calling implementations.","intents":["How can I integrate multiple APIs into my agent's workflow?","What is the best way to define and validate function calls in my MCP server?","Can I ensure type safety when calling external functions from my agent?"],"best_for":["developers building multi-provider integrations for LLM agents"],"limitations":["Requires manual schema definition for each API, which can be time-consuming"],"requires":["Node.js 14+","MCP-compatible API keys"],"input_types":["structured data"],"output_types":["structured data","text"],"categories":["tool-use-integration","api orchestration"],"confidence":0.5,"matches":0,"success_rate":0},{"id":"smithery_nova-3951-agents-md__cap_1","uri":"capability://memory.knowledge.contextual.agent.state.management","name":"contextual agent state management","description":"This capability manages the state of agents by maintaining contextual information across interactions. It employs a context management pattern that allows agents to retain relevant data from previous interactions, enhancing their ability to respond intelligently. This is achieved through a centralized state store that agents can query and update, making it distinct from stateless implementations.","intents":["How can I maintain context between user interactions in my agent?","What is the best way to manage state for multiple agents?","Can my agent remember previous conversations or actions?"],"best_for":["teams developing conversational agents that require memory"],"limitations":["State persistence is not built-in; requires external storage solutions"],"requires":["Redis or similar state store","Node.js 14+"],"input_types":["text","structured data"],"output_types":["text","structured data"],"categories":["memory-knowledge","context management"],"confidence":0.5,"matches":0,"success_rate":0},{"id":"smithery_nova-3951-agents-md__cap_2","uri":"capability://automation.workflow.multi.agent.orchestration","name":"multi-agent orchestration","description":"This capability enables the coordination of multiple agents to work together towards a common goal. It uses an orchestration pattern that defines workflows and communication protocols between agents, allowing them to share information and tasks efficiently. This collaborative approach is distinct as it facilitates complex interactions that single agents cannot achieve alone.","intents":["How can I coordinate multiple agents to solve a problem?","What is the best way to manage workflows involving several agents?","Can my agents communicate and share data with each other?"],"best_for":["developers creating complex systems with multiple interacting agents"],"limitations":["Increased complexity in managing agent interactions and workflows"],"requires":["Node.js 14+","MCP-compatible agent definitions"],"input_types":["structured data","text"],"output_types":["structured data","text"],"categories":["automation-workflow","orchestration"],"confidence":0.5,"matches":0,"success_rate":0},{"id":"smithery_nova-3951-agents-md__cap_3","uri":"capability://tool.use.integration.dynamic.api.integration","name":"dynamic api integration","description":"This capability allows agents to dynamically integrate with new APIs at runtime, adapting to changing requirements without needing to redeploy. It leverages a plugin architecture that enables agents to load and configure API integrations on-the-fly, making it distinct from static integration approaches.","intents":["How can I add new API integrations to my agent without downtime?","What is the best way to make my agent adaptable to new services?","Can my agent support custom APIs that are not predefined?"],"best_for":["developers building flexible, adaptable agents"],"limitations":["Dynamic loading may introduce latency during initial integration"],"requires":["Node.js 14+","API specifications for new integrations"],"input_types":["structured data"],"output_types":["structured data","text"],"categories":["tool-use-integration","plugin systems"],"confidence":0.5,"matches":0,"success_rate":0},{"id":"smithery_nova-3951-agents-md__cap_4","uri":"capability://automation.workflow.event.driven.agent.interactions","name":"event-driven agent interactions","description":"This capability enables agents to respond to events in real-time, using an event-driven architecture that listens for specific triggers to initiate actions. Agents can subscribe to various events and execute predefined workflows based on those triggers, making it distinct from traditional request-response models.","intents":["How can my agent react to external events or changes in data?","What is the best way to implement real-time interactions in my agent?","Can my agent perform actions based on user-defined events?"],"best_for":["developers creating responsive, real-time agents"],"limitations":["Event handling complexity can increase the overall system's difficulty"],"requires":["Node.js 14+","event source configurations"],"input_types":["events","structured data"],"output_types":["text","structured data"],"categories":["automation-workflow","orchestration"],"confidence":0.5,"matches":0,"success_rate":0}],"trust":{"score":27,"verified":false,"data_access_risk":"moderate","permissions":["Node.js 14+","MCP-compatible API keys","Redis or similar state store","MCP-compatible agent definitions","API specifications for new integrations","event source configurations"],"failure_modes":["Requires manual schema definition for each API, which can be time-consuming","State persistence is not built-in; requires external storage solutions","Increased complexity in managing agent interactions and workflows","Dynamic loading may introduce latency during initial integration","Event handling complexity can increase the overall system's difficulty","builder identity is not verified yet","no observed match outcomes yet"],"rank_breakdown":{"adoption":0.05,"quality":0.2,"ecosystem":0.48999999999999994,"match_graph":0.25,"freshness":0.6,"weights":{"adoption":0.25,"quality":0.25,"ecosystem":0.15,"match_graph":0.23,"freshness":0.12}},"observed_outcomes":{"matches":0,"success_rate":0,"avg_confidence":0,"top_intents":[],"last_matched_at":null},"maintenance":{"status":"active","updated_at":"2026-05-24T12:16:27.443Z","last_scraped_at":"2026-05-03T15:19:22.209Z","last_commit":null},"community":{"stars":null,"forks":null,"weekly_downloads":null,"model_downloads":null,"model_likes":null}},"distribution":{"claim_url":"https://unfragile.ai/submit?claim=nova-3951-agents-md","compare_url":"https://unfragile.ai/compare?artifact=nova-3951-agents-md"}},"signature":"r78eZ/w7IzPM7DYjBSXLRo10jsHT5VX5mJxcWFYyxIs4Oz3c6AGMpnrXqqXP6QYwLaNzwbEnjNwTSGuU1BcBBA==","signedAt":"2026-06-21T16:03:47.426Z","signedBy":"unfragile.ai","version":1},"_links":{"self":"https://unfragile.ai/api/v1/passport/nova-3951-agents-md","artifact":"https://unfragile.ai/nova-3951-agents-md","verify":"https://unfragile.ai/api/v1/verify?slug=nova-3951-agents-md","publicKey":"https://unfragile.ai/api/v1/trust-passport-public-key","spec":"https://unfragile.ai/trust","schema":"https://unfragile.ai/schema.json","docs":"https://unfragile.ai/docs"}}